The program duration is set for 36 months, making it a full-time commitment that allows students to fully immerse themselves in the arts. The annual tuition fee for the Bachelor of Fine Arts in Fine and Studio Art is approximately GBP 15,500, making it a cost-effective option for students seeking quality education in the creative arts. The University of Cumbria also offers various scholarships and bursaries to assist students in funding their studies, making education more accessible to all backgrounds.
Admission to the program requires students to have at least five GCSEs at grade C or above, including English Language and Mathematics. For international applicants, a minimum of 24 points in the International Baccalaureate Diploma, including 6 points in Higher Level English Language and Mathematics, is necessary. All applicants must submit a portfolio showcasing their artistic work, which plays a crucial role in the selection process.
